Holi is one of the most ancient and widely celebrated Hindu festivals, with its origins tracing back to various Puranic legends. The most prominent story involves the demoness Holika and Prahlada, a devotee of Vishnu. Holika, immune to fire, attempted to burn Prahlada but was herself consumed, while Prahlada emerged unscathed, signifying the victory of devotion and virtue. Another legend connects Holi with the divine love of Radha and Krishna, emphasizing the playful throwing of colors.

Historically, Holi marks the end of winter and the advent of spring, celebrating fertility, harvest, and new life. Its timing is determined by the Hindu lunisolar calendar, specifically on the Purnima (full moon day) of the Phalgun month. The primary festivities typically span two days: Holika Dahan (or Chhoti Holi) and Rangwali Holi (or Dhuleti). Holika Dahan involves lighting bonfires on the evening before Rangwali Holi, symbolizing the burning of evil. Rangwali Holi is the day of playful color throwing, feasting, and community gathering. Q1: What is holi 2026 calendar with holidays?
The holi 2026 calendar with holidays refers to the specific dates and associated observances for the Hindu festival of Holi in the year 2026. These dates are determined by the Hindu lunisolar calendar, typically falling on the full moon day (Purnima) of the month of Phalgun. For 2026, Holika Dahan, which marks the evening before the main celebrations, is expected to fall on Wednesday, March 4, 2026. The main day of colors, Rangwali Holi or Dhuleti, will be observed on Thursday, March 5, 2026. This calendar provides the crucial information for planning and participating in the festival.
